We-Ko-Pa Casino Resort has posted its list of concerts for the month of May.
All concerts start at 8 p.m. and are for ages 21 and over. Free concerts are held at WKP Sports & Entertainment. Paid concerts are held in the We-Ko-Pa Casino Resort Conference Center.
We-Ko-Pa Casino Resort is located at 10438 Wekopa Way in Fort McDowell.

May 3: ‘Soulitify;’ free concert
The soul of the Valley, this all-star cover band boasts top-notch musicians who deliver a concert-like experience as they perform favorite tunes.
May 9: ‘9-11 Dangerous Band;’ free concert
The ultimate “Kool & The Gang” tribute band, “911-Dangerous Band” delivers classic Motown and iconic R&B hits in an explosive, spiritual and overwhelming musical performance.
May 10: Teo Gonzalez
Get ready for a night of nonstop laughter as legendary Mexican comedian Teo González takes the stage. Known as “El Comediante de la Cola de Caballo,” González’s signature humor and unforgettable storytelling have made him a fan favorite across generations. For tickets, visits bit.ly/tickets_wekopa.
May 10: ‘Sleek;’ free concert
One of Arizona’s top rock trios featuring Aaron Bigsby on lead vocals and guitar.
May 16: ‘Arizona Blacktop;’ free concert
Playing everything from country hits to classic rock and modern pop, “Arizona Blacktop” delivers a high-energy performance with a fresh twist and polished finish. Featuring soulful and versatile male and female vocals backed by Arizona’s finest musicians, the band brings danceable, boot-scootin’ fun.
May 17: 'Englebert Humperdinck'
Legendary crooner “Engelbert Humperdinck” takes the stage for “The Last Waltz Tour,” an unforgettable evening of timeless hits and heartfelt melodies. With a career spanning more than five decades, Engelbert has sold more than 140 million records, earned 64 gold and 35 platinum albums and captivated audiences worldwide with his signature voice and charm. visit bit.ly/tickets_wekopa.
May 17: ‘Big Chad & the Southern Gentlemen;’ free concert
An original groove rock band with a unique style, “Big Chad & the Southern Gentlemen” brings a roots-based, groove rock sound and heavy vocal harmonies for a truly one-of-a-kind musical performance.
May 23: 'Robert Creelman & The Crossroads;’ free concert
The Valley’s hottest dance band, “Robert Creelman & The Crossroads” are keeping traditional country music alive. They bring the best of legends like “Merle Haggard,” “George Jones,” “Alan Jackson,” “George Strait” and “Dwight Yoakam,” along with their own original tunes that are pure country magic.
May 24: ‘Thaddeus Rose;’ free concert
Led by front man Thaddeus Rose, this talented variety band offers flawless remakes of iconic cover tunes and the best dance rock hits of all time.
May 30: ‘Checker’d Past;’ free concert
A tribute to ‘80s top tunes, new wave favorites and one-hit wonders, “Checker’d Past” performs some of the great music of the video era. Those who remember watching MTV will love reliving the iconic music, fun and frivolity of the ‘80s in a show described as “authentic as the day music first hit the radio.”
